The Higher the Magnification - The More Detail You'll See

Magnification can represent combinations of lenses including objective, ocular, and auxiliary lenses. The magnification ranges described here may include these combinations.

Compound Microscopes may include additional eyepieces (ocular lenses) to expand the total magnification range.

Stereo and other Inspection Microscopes may include additional eyepieces and auxiliary lenses including Barlow lenses to expand the total magnification range.

Camera Types

Various types of cameras are available. Cameras intended to be used with computers will use USB, wi-fi, or LAN to connect to the computer, and typically include specialized software. Cameras with HDMI, VGA, or analog video interfaces can be attached directly to a compatible display device such as a monitor or television, and do not require a computer to operate.

Camera Pixels

Also referred to as camera resolution, the number of pixels represents the maximum size of images which can be displayed or recorded by a camera. The value is displayed using MP (megapixels).

Phase Contrast Kit:

  • 10X phase contrast objective: Achromatic PH10/0.25, 160/0.17 (with phase plate)
  • 40X phase contrast objective: Achromatic PH40/0.65, 160/0.17 (with phase plate)
  • 100X phase contrast objective: Achromatic PH100/1.25, 160/0.17, Oil (with phase plate)
  • Condenser: NA1.25 ( 37mm mounting size)
  • 10X condenser annular plate
  • 40X condenser annular plate
  • 100X condenser annular plate
  • One green filter
  • One centering telescopic eyepiece
